Description
Summary:We report, for the first time, the N-terminal amino acid sequences of both intact and cleaved forms (fragments A and B) of Mung bean nuclease, purified from sprouts of Vigna radiata or purchased from Amersham Biosciences. The N-terminal sequence of Mung bean nuclease shows high similarity with the putative bifunctional nuclease from Arabidopsis thaliana (AC: AAM63596).
